2

Remote Machine Learning Compiler Engineer Jobs in Alameda, CA

We have hybrid offices in London, New York, and Singapore; this role is remote based in the San Francisco area. This Role As a Machine Learning Engineer, you'll work closely with our Data Scientists ...

We have hybrid offices in London, New York, and Singapore; this role is remote based in the San Francisco area. This Role As a Machine Learning Engineer, you'll work closely with our Data Scientists ...

Machine Learning Engineer

San Francisco, CA · On-site +1

$164K - $266K/yr

What you'll do As a Machine Learning Engineer on the AI Platform team, you will design and build ... Employee divides their time between in-office and remote work. Access to an office location is ...

Company Description PatternAI is an automated machine learning platform that reveals critical patterns in data for narrow business problems. We're seeking an outstanding ML Engineer to join our data ...

Senior Machine Learning Engineer

San Francisco, CA · On-site +1

$123K - $169K/yr

Position Overview As a Senior Machine Learning Engineer, you will play a key role in designing ... This role is currently open to remote work. Candidates must be located near one of our hub ...

Senior Machine Learning Engineer

Brisbane, CA · On-site +1

$125K - $172K/yr

Senior Machine Learning Engineer Brisbane, California About This Opportunity: At Freenome, we are ... remote. What You'll Do: * Implement and refine DL pipelines on distributed computing platforms ...

next page

Showing results 1-20

Remote Machine Learning Compiler Engineer information

See Alameda, CA salary details

$85K

$189.8K

$232.3K

How much do remote machine learning compiler engineer jobs pay per year?

As of Jun 19, 2026, the average yearly pay for remote machine learning compiler engineer in Alameda, CA is $189,767.00, according to ZipRecruiter salary data. Most workers in this role earn between $162,100.00 and $232,300.00 per year, depending on experience, location, and employer.

How does a Remote Machine Learning Compiler Engineer typically collaborate with cross-functional teams to optimize model deployment?

As a Remote Machine Learning Compiler Engineer, you will frequently collaborate with data scientists, hardware engineers, and software developers to ensure that machine learning models are efficiently compiled and deployed on target platforms. Communication often takes place through virtual meetings, code reviews, and shared documentation tools. You'll be responsible for translating research models into optimized code, troubleshooting performance bottlenecks, and integrating feedback from various stakeholders. Effective teamwork is crucial, as the success of deployments often depends on iterative feedback and close alignment with both the ML research and hardware teams.

What is a Remote Machine Learning Compiler Engineer?

A Remote Machine Learning Compiler Engineer is a software engineer who specializes in developing and optimizing compilers specifically for machine learning workloads, while working from a remote location. Their primary responsibilities include designing and implementing compiler features that translate machine learning models into efficient code for various hardware platforms, such as CPUs, GPUs, or specialized accelerators. They collaborate closely with machine learning researchers, hardware engineers, and software developers to ensure high performance and compatibility. In addition to strong programming skills, they typically require expertise in compiler theory, machine learning frameworks, and hardware architectures. This role allows for flexible, location-independent work while contributing to cutting-edge AI technologies.

What is the difference between Remote Machine Learning Compiler Engineer vs Remote Data Scientist?

AspectRemote Machine Learning Compiler EngineerRemote Data Scientist
Required CredentialsBachelor's or Master's in Computer Science, Software Engineering, or related fields; knowledge of compiler design and ML frameworksBachelor's or Master's in Data Science, Statistics, or related fields; proficiency in programming, statistics, and data analysis
Work EnvironmentPrimarily software development, compiler optimization, and ML model deploymentData analysis, model building, and interpretation of results
Industry UsageTech companies, AI startups, hardware firms focusing on ML hardware accelerationTech, finance, healthcare, and research organizations

While both roles involve working with machine learning, the Remote Machine Learning Compiler Engineer focuses on developing and optimizing compilers for ML models, whereas the Remote Data Scientist concentrates on analyzing data and building predictive models. The roles share some technical skills but differ in their core responsibilities and work environments.

What are the key skills and qualifications needed to thrive as a Remote Machine Learning Compiler Engineer, and why are they important?

To thrive as a Remote Machine Learning Compiler Engineer, you need a strong background in computer science, proficiency in programming languages like C++ and Python, and expertise in compiler theory and machine learning frameworks. Familiarity with ML compilers such as TVM or XLA, and experience using version control and CI/CD systems are commonly required, along with a relevant bachelor's or master's degree. Outstanding problem-solving, collaboration, and communication skills are essential for working effectively in distributed teams and across technical domains. These skills and qualities enable the development of efficient, scalable ML solutions that bridge software and hardware, ensuring high performance and innovation.
What are popular job titles related to Remote Machine Learning Compiler Engineer jobs in Alameda, CA? For Remote Machine Learning Compiler Engineer jobs in Alameda, CA, the most frequently searched job titles are:
What job categories do people searching Remote Machine Learning Compiler Engineer jobs in Alameda, CA look for? The top searched job categories for Remote Machine Learning Compiler Engineer jobs in Alameda, CA are:
What cities near Alameda, CA are hiring for Remote Machine Learning Compiler Engineer jobs? Cities near Alameda, CA with the most Remote Machine Learning Compiler Engineer job openings:
Compiler Engineer - Machine Learning Compiler

Compiler Engineer - Machine Learning Compiler

Mythic

Palo Alto, CA • Remote

Full-time

Posted 13 days ago


Job description

About us

Mythic is building the future of AI computing with breakthrough analog technology that delivers 100× the performance of traditional digital systems at the same power and cost. This unlocks bigger, more capable models and faster, more responsive applications—whether in edge devices like drones, robotics, and sensors, or in cloud and data center environments. Our technology powers everything from large language models and CNNs to advanced signal processing, and is engineered to operate from –40 °C to +125 °C, making it ideal for industrial, automotive, aerospace, and defense.
We’ve raised over $100M from world-class investors including Softbank, Threshold Ventures, Lux Capital, and DCVC, and secured multi-million-dollar customer contracts across multiple markets.

About the role

Join us in building the next generation of AI compilers. You’ll play a key role in developing the compiler for our novel AI accelerator, working side-by-side with hardware engineers and ML researchers. Your work will shape how deep learning workloads run on cutting-edge dataflow hardware—defining the instruction set, execution model, and developer experience. The result: a compiler that delivers breakthrough performance while remaining seamless and intuitive for ML developers.
Here's what you will do
  • Contribute across the full compiler stack, including operator lowering, graph/IR transformations, optimization passes, and backend code generation
  • Optimize for dataflow architectures, developing pipelined schedules, memory orchestration, and resource-constrained execution strategies
  • Collaborate with hardware architects to influence architectural features, ensuring the compiler and hardware evolve together
  • Develop compilation strategies that unify our analog compute with digital subsystems
  • Build and maintain a compiler that produces high-performance binaries with strong debugging support, clear error messages, and predictable performance models
Here's the background we hope you will have
  • 3+ years of experience building compilers or high-performance systems software, especially those involving complex resource management or optimization.
  • Expert in modern C++ (C++14/17/20) and strong Python.
  • Experience with compiler IRs (SSA-based or graph-based), transformations, and code generation
  • Exposure to specialized accelerators (GPU, NPU, FPGA, or custom ASIC) or parallel architectures
The following would be nice to have, but is not required
  • Experience with machine learning compiler stacks (e.g., ONNX, MLIR, TVM, XLA, IREE, PyTorch), with contributions to MLIR or LLVM projects a plus
  • Experience with optimization methods (LP/MIP, CP, SAT/SMT) using solvers like Gurobi or OR-Tools for scheduling and resource allocation
  • Experience compiling for specialized accelerators (GPU, NPU, FPGA, or custom ASIC) on DNN workloads; GPU/DSP experience is valuable if combined with compiler backend work beyond kernel tuning
  • Familiarity with heterogeneous compilation, especially mixing custom accelerators with CPUs/GPUs/NPUs, and exposure to analog or in-memory compute is a plus
  • Experience collaborating in compiler–hardware co-design (architecture + ISA) for better compiler usability and hardware efficiency
What we offer
  • The opportunity to shape how deep learning and LLM workloads are compiled on novel hardware.
  • A role that spans software and hardware co-design, shaping both the compiler and the accelerator architecture
  • A collaborative, innovative team that values engineering rigor, continuous integration, and user-focused design. We foster an environment of shared learning and technical excellence
  • Competitive compensation, equity, and benefits package
At Mythic, we foster a collaborative and respectful environment where people can do their best work. We hire smart, capable individuals, provide the tools and support they need, and trust them to deliver. Our team brings a wide range of experiences and perspectives, which we see as a strength in solving hard problems together. We value professionalism, creativity, and integrity, and strive to make Mythic a place where every employee feels they belong and can contribute meaningfully.